What is the finest kind of hob for a novice cook?
Gas hobs are often advised for beginners due to their responsiveness, allowing simple adjustment of heat levels.
2. Are induction hobs worth the investment?
While induction hobs can be more expensive in advance, they offer energy performance and faster cooking times, making them a beneficial long-lasting financial investment for numerous.
3. How do convection ovens differ from conventional ovens?
Convection ovens have fans that distribute hot air for even cooking, while conventional ovens depend on glowing heat from heating elements, which can produce hot spots.
4. Can I utilize any cookware on an induction hob?
No, induction hobs require ferrous (magnetic) pots and pans. This includes cast iron and some stainless-steel, however excludes aluminum and glass pots and pans.
5. How frequently should I clean my oven?
It is recommended to carry out a thorough clean every 3-6 months however clean down spills as quickly as they take place.
